Great base for Úbeda, Baeza and Jaén.
Posted 3 May 2019 on HotelsLovely old style hotel. We travelled in late April so it was reasonably quiet. The air conditioning in our part of the hotel was central a/c and wasn’t due to be switched over from heat for a few weeks (or so we were told by the very helpful staff). This meant we were very hot at night as we had some unusually warm weather. The a/c was eventually switched on on 1st May so it may be worth checking if this is something you think may affect your trip. We had great views from our room with large patio doors, the room was very clean and serviced daily.
The ‘gym’ was basic and appeared to be poorly maintained with an old bike, one working cross trainer and one broken one, some free weights and broken multi -gym.
We only had breakfast , no other meals, it was typically Spanish style, a good range of meats, eggs, ham, cheeses, cereals, pastries, breads etc. coffee was good too.
Hotel is located slightly out of the historic area, about 15 walk to the start of the sites but right by a Lidl and Carrefour if you need one! Parking can be paid for at hotel €10 a day but we found free street parking and regularly a free spot near the Carrefour petrol station!
Overall, the hotel and staff were very good and we would stay again.
